Snapped camshaft at idle.
 
Well.....very stupid and difficult lesson learned. I was recharging the air conditioning system after installing a different A/C compressor and while at idle I heard a sharp clank and the engine died. I pulled the belts to access the timing belt cover and the belt was snapped. Grabbing the front cam sprocket, it just turns and can be pulled out about an inch, therefore snapped cam.

I know I'll need a new camshaft and will know more once I pull the head off next weekend. Anyone who has a cam keep this in mind as I continue the work later.

My error was in not waiting to fabricate crankshaft holding tool so I could replace the belt. That's the stupid lesson learned....patience!!!!

Pull the cam and check for lifter damage; since it happened at low engine speed and the cam breaking acts as a safety valve of sorts, you might get lucky and get away with minimal damage.

Anyone who has been running on a belt of unknown age or unknown installation method should be taking heed now, before this turns into a full-scale epidemic...!

+1, the crank bolt absolutely must to be tighter than anything most people have ever installed on a car. I think failed cambelt service has killed almost as many cars as cooling system/HG failure.

I weigh 150, so I stand on the end of a 2'3" lever to tighten the bolt, and use threadlocker.

Unfortunately, when a seller claims it was done, there is a real chance it was done wrong.

1. As mentioned above, is there a special wrench for the 17mm bolts that mount the IP bracket to the block, the ones to adjust the belt tension?

I use what I have; Craftsman combo boxend wrench. Tedious work, lots of small turns. Maybe a gearwrench ratcheting boxend wrench would help? Once I removed the fuel filter housing and wrenched from below, which seemed easier. Some hoist the IP and heavy bracket during removal with a cherry picker (helps maintain slack on the bolts) (and saves your back when lifting it out).

You'll want to cover up those distributor valves on the IP pressure head. Wrap some tinfoil around them if you don't have correctly sized plastic caps. Important to keep foreign matter out of the fuel system.

I use a 17 ratchet wrench on the pump bracket bolts, and it isn't hard. I have both flex head and regular, IIRC, I use the regular more.
the bracket is the engine lift point, so if you will be pulling that, maybe leave i ton.

For the buried allen, I use a ball ended 3/8" extension, and a regular allen socket, and it works fine.
